Job Description
Engineer-in-Training - Construction Management
Department: Construction Management
Employment Type: Full Time
Location: Meridian, ID
Compensation: $70,000 - $83,200 / year
Description
What are the core responsibilities for the role?
• Perform field inspections, materials testing, and daily reporting, particularly during the first two years
• Develop working knowledge of construction plans, specifications, and contracts
• Operate survey equipment, MIT scanners, testing equipment, and other measurement tools to verify compliance with contract requirements
• Utilize spreadsheets, databases, CAD programs, and construction management software to support contractor payments and track testing frequencies
• Research technical topics and apply relevant standards, manuals, and regulations
• Communicate effectively with contractors, inspectors, and clients to support project delivery
• Provide technical recommendations based on field experience
• Obtain Professional Engineer licensure
• Develop skills in project management, client service, invoicing, and team supervision
Qualifications, Skills, and Competencies:
• FE exam completion preferred but not required at time of hire
• Ability to obtain ITD inspection and WAQTC testing certifications
• Strong written and verbal communication skills
• Str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and reliability
• Self-motivated with a strong work ethic and desire to learn
• Ability to maintain professionalism in high-pressure or challenging situations
Work Environment and Requirements:
• Ability to work 50 to 60 hours per week during peak construction season
• Ability to travel and work out of town as needed
• Ability to work in field environments on active construction sites
